SQL for Data Analysts: Why It’s the Most Important Skill Today

Introduction: Why SQL Has Become Non-Negotiable for Data Analysts

Every business depends on data. Companies collect millions of records every day from websites, apps, sensors, transactions, and customer interactions. But data alone means nothing until analysts make sense of it. This is why SQL has become the most important skill for anyone entering data analytics.

Whether you take a data analyst course online, join data analyst online classes, or enroll in an online analytics course, SQL appears as the core skill you must learn from day one. It helps you access data, clean it, analyze it, and turn it into insights that drive decisions.

Industry surveys show that more than 70 percent of data analytics job postings list SQL as a mandatory requirement. Companies rely on SQL because it provides speed, accuracy, and direct access to data that analysts need to make meaningful judgments.

This blog explains why SQL sits at the center of every Data Analytics course, how it powers real-world analytics, and why mastering SQL through structured data analytics training can shape your entire career.


What Is SQL and Why Every Data Analyst Must Know It

SQL stands for Structured Query Language. It helps you communicate with relational databases that store large volumes of structured data. Businesses depend on relational databases because they offer organized, secure, and reliable ways to store information.

Here is what SQL allows a data analyst to do:

  • Retrieve data quickly

  • Filter and sort records

  • Combine fields from multiple tables

  • Calculate summaries and aggregates

  • Build reports for business decisions

  • Create views that simplify complex data

  • Clean and transform raw data

Think of SQL as your direct bridge to data. No matter which Data Analytics certification you take, SQL remains the foundation because it provides clear control over the information you want to analyze.

Why SQL Is the Most Important Skill for Data Analysts Today

Below are the major reasons why SQL has become essential in data analytics roles.

1. SQL Helps You Work Directly with Company Databases

Every organization stores its data in a database. For example:

  • Banks store customer records, transactions, and branch details.

  • E-commerce companies track orders, product lists, payments, and users.

  • Hospitals store patient details, diagnostic results, and doctor schedules.

  • Telecom companies store call logs, tower usage, and customer plans.

As a data analyst, you need this data to answer business questions. SQL gives you the power to extract and explore this information without depending on developers or IT teams.

This is why every major Data Analytics course, including programs similar to the Google data analytics certification, teaches SQL at the very beginning.

2. SQL Makes Data Cleaning Faster and More Accurate

Almost 60 to 80 percent of a data analyst’s job involves data cleaning. You must handle issues such as:

  • Duplicate entries

  • Missing values

  • Incorrect formats

  • Inconsistent naming

  • Invalid records

SQL allows analysts to identify and correct these problems easily.

Example

Find duplicate customer records:

SELECT email, COUNT(*)

FROM customers

GROUP BY email

HAVING COUNT(*) > 1;

Remove records with missing phone numbers:

DELETE FROM customers WHERE phone IS NULL;

Clean data faster → Produce better insights → Make confident decisions.

3. SQL Makes Complex Analysis Easy

You can answer important business questions using SQL. For example:

What are the top 10 best-selling products?

SELECT product_name, SUM(quantity) AS total_sold

FROM sales

GROUP BY product_name

ORDER BY total_sold DESC

LIMIT 10;


Which customer group spends the most?

SELECT customer_type, AVG(amount_spent) AS avg_spend

FROM transactions

GROUP BY customer_type;


SQL helps analysts generate these insights instantly, even if the database contains millions of records.

4. SQL Is Used in Every Analytics Job Role

Whether you work in finance, healthcare, retail, logistics, or IT services, SQL remains the common skill that all data analysts must use daily.

Here are job roles where SQL is essential:

  • Data Analyst

  • Business Analyst

  • Reporting Analyst

  • Marketing Analyst

  • Product Analyst

  • Financial Analyst

  • Operations Analyst

Even those who take analytics classes online or pursue data analyst certification online soon realize that SQL remains the backbone of analytical work.

5. SQL Powers Machine Learning and Data Engineering

Many analysts move into advanced career paths such as:

  • Data Science

  • Machine Learning

  • Data Engineering

  • Business Intelligence

  • Cloud Analytics

SQL supports these roles because machine learning models and BI tools also depend on structured data pulled from SQL databases. You may use Python, R, Power BI, Tableau, or cloud tools, but SQL gives you the clean and well-organized data these tools require.

6. SQL Is the Easiest Programming Language to Learn

Many beginners think data analytics requires advanced coding, but SQL is simple and human-friendly. For example:

SELECT name FROM employees WHERE salary > 50000;


You can read this like an English sentence. This is why SQL is introduced in the first week of every Data Analytics course.

Even learners from non-IT backgrounds find SQL easy to pick up because it uses clear commands and logical structure.

Real-World Examples: How Companies Use SQL Every Day

Let’s look at practical examples of SQL in action.

E-Commerce Example

Business question: Which products have the highest return rate?

SELECT product_id, 

       COUNT(*) AS total_returns

FROM returns

GROUP BY product_id

ORDER BY total_returns DESC;


This helps brands understand product defects, customer behavior, and quality issues.

Banking Example

Business question: Which customers are at risk of account inactivity?

SELECT customer_id, 

       MAX(transaction_date) AS last_active

FROM transactions

GROUP BY customer_id

HAVING MAX(transaction_date) < '2024-01-01';


Banks use SQL to target inactive customers with re-engagement offers.

Healthcare Example

Business question: Which departments have maximum patient visits?

SELECT department, COUNT(*) AS visits

FROM appointments

GROUP BY department

ORDER BY visits DESC;


Hospitals use this to allocate staff and resources.

Telecom Example

Business question: Which data plans are customers using the most?

SELECT plan_id, COUNT(*) AS users

FROM subscriptions

GROUP BY plan_id

ORDER BY users DESC;


Telecom companies use this to design new plans and adjust pricing.

How SQL Fits Into a Complete Data Analyst Skill Set

A data analyst must know more than SQL, but SQL forms the foundation that supports every other skill.

Below is the typical skill stack taught in a structured data analytics training program.

1. SQL for Data Extraction

This is where you start. SQL helps you access and organize data from databases.

2. Excel or Google Sheets

Used for quick calculations, pivot tables, and small datasets.

3. Python or R

Used for advanced analysis, modeling, or automation.

4. Data Visualization Tools

Tableau, Power BI, or similar tools depend on SQL-ready data to build charts and dashboards.

5. Domain Knowledge

You must understand the business problem before solving it.

6. Storytelling and Reporting

You must present insights in a clear and meaningful way.

SQL fuels every stage of this workflow. Analysts first use SQL to extract and clean data before moving to visualization or modeling.

Step-by-Step Guide: How Beginners Can Learn SQL Effectively

If you take a Data analyst course online, the SQL component usually follows a structured approach like this:

Step 1: Learn the Basic Commands

You start with simple keywords:

  • SELECT

  • FROM

  • WHERE

  • GROUP BY

  • ORDER BY

  • JOIN

  • LIMIT

These commands allow you to write basic queries within the first week.

Step 2: Learn How Joins Work

Joins allow you to combine information from multiple tables. For example:

SELECT c.name, o.order_date

FROM customers c

JOIN orders o

ON c.customer_id = o.customer_id;


This type of query is used in almost every project.

Step 3: Work with Aggregations

You learn how to calculate:

  • Sums

  • Averages

  • Minimum and maximum values

  • Counts

  • Percentages

Step 4: Clean Data Using SQL

In this stage, you practice removing duplicates, fixing missing values, and formatting data correctly.

Step 5: Build Real Projects

A strong Online analytics course or data analyst certification online includes projects such as:

  • Sales analysis

  • Customer segmentation

  • Healthcare reporting

  • Financial trend analysis

  • Marketing campaign performance

Projects help you gain confidence with real data.

Step 6: Prepare for Job Interviews

Most employers test SQL using:

  • Live coding tasks

  • Multiple-choice questions

  • Real business problems

  • Case studies

Structured training and practice help you answer these confidently.

Why SQL Stands Out in Every Data Analytics Interview

Recruiters evaluate SQL proficiency during hiring because:

  • It shows your analytical thinking

  • It proves you can handle real company data

  • It indicates you can work independently

  • It demonstrates your readiness for analytics roles

Surveys show that SQL-related tasks form more than 40 percent of data analytics interview questions. Knowing SQL increases your chance of getting shortlisted and selected.

Industry Demand: Why Companies Are Hiring SQL-Skilled Analysts

Organizations across all industries seek professionals who have strong SQL skills. The rise of digital transformation has increased SQL usage in:

  • Cloud databases

  • Big data platforms

  • Business intelligence systems

  • Automation pipelines

  • Real-time data dashboards

More data → More analytics → More demand for SQL

This is why every Data Analytics certification and Data Analytics classes online emphasizes SQL as a primary skill.

How H2K Infosys Helps You Build Strong SQL Skills

H2K Infosys offers a structured Data Analytics course designed to help beginners and working professionals gain job-ready skills. Some highlights include:

  • Live instructor-led SQL sessions

  • Hands-on query writing and debugging

  • Real-time projects using SQL databases

  • Assignments, exercises, and case studies

  • Step-by-step explanation from fundamentals to advanced joins

  • Support for interview preparation

  • Training aligned with industry expectations

Whether you join data analyst online classes or take a full data analytics training program, H2K Infosys ensures you master SQL through practice rather than theory.

Key Takeaways

  • SQL is the most important skill for data analysts today.

  • It helps you extract, clean, and analyze data stored in company databases.

  • SQL supports advanced analytics, machine learning, and reporting tools.

  • Every Data analyst course online and online analytics course teaches SQL as the first module.

  • Learning SQL increases your chances of landing a job in analytics.

  • H2K Infosys provides practical, project-based SQL training to build your confidence.

Conclusion: Your Data Analytics Career Starts with SQL

SQL is the skill that every data analyst must master to succeed. Join H2K Infosys to learn SQL with hands-on projects and real-world training. Enroll today to start building the skills that employers value most.



Comments

Popular posts from this blog